idea打包成docker镜像
时间: 2023-11-08 12:06:50 浏览: 163
将 IDEA 项目打包成 Docker 镜像,需要以下步骤:
1. 编写 Dockerfile 文件,指定基础镜像、安装依赖、拷贝代码等操作。
2. 使用 Docker 命令构建镜像,例如:`docker build -t my-image:1.0 .`。
3. 运行镜像,例如:`docker run -p 8080:8080 my-image:1.0`。
具体操作步骤可以参考以下文章:
- [Dockerizing a Java Application](https://spring.io/guides/gs/spring-boot-docker/)
- [Dockerize your Java Application](https://www.baeldung.com/dockerizing-java-app)
相关问题
idea打包vue docker镜像
要打包Vue Docker镜像,您需要按照以下步骤操作:
1. 首先,您需要在本地计算机上安装Docker。
2. 然后,您需要在Vue项目的根目录下创建一个名为Dockerfile的文件。
3. 在Dockerfile中,您需要指定要使用的基础镜像,例如node:latest。
4. 接下来,您需要将Vue项目的所有文件复制到Docker镜像中。
5. 您还需要运行npm install命令来安装所有依赖项。
6. 最后,您需要指定要运行的命令,例如npm run serve。
7. 保存Dockerfile并在终端中导航到Vue项目的根目录。
8. 运行docker build命令来构建Docker镜像。
9. 最后,您可以使用docker run命令来运行Docker容器并访问Vue应用程序。
希望这些步骤可以帮助您打包Vue Docker镜像。
idea maven打包docker镜像
使用Maven可以很方便地打包Docker镜像。首先需要在pom.xml文件中添加Docker插件,然后在命令行中执行mvn package命令即可生成Docker镜像。在执行命令时需要指定Dockerfile的路径和镜像的名称和版本号。例如:
mvn package docker:build -Ddockerfile=./Dockerfile -Dtag=myimage:1.
这个命令会在当前目录下查找Dockerfile文件,并将生成的镜像命名为myimage:1.。需要注意的是,执行该命令前需要确保已经安装了Docker,并且当前用户有Docker的执行权限。
阅读全文